Jesus Is Enough (Galatians 1:1-10)

This letter to the Galatians is about the amazing assurance that believers have in Jesus Christ. It’s about the good news that we have been rescued from bondage and slavery and a religion of law and works. It’s about how we have been set free because of the full and complete work of Jesus. The Apostle Paul wrote this letter 2,000 years ago because this very truth was under attack. Listen in as we see why the truth of the Gospel is worth fighting for, and how we can stand against false teaching in our own day.

The Book of Galatians is one of the Apostle Paul’s most impassioned and eloquent letters. It warns Christians about the dangers of both legalism and lawlessness, calling Believers to live in the freedom of a gospel-shaped life. Throughout this book we will encounter the promises, warnings, and gospel declarations that will help us find true liberty in our identity as God’s adopted children.
